From 65bba93afa9ca5305180415371ee4a889485c84f Mon Sep 17 00:00:00 2001 From: Pau Espin Pedrol Date: Mon, 26 Jul 2021 12:06:20 +0200 Subject: tests: tbf: Fix dl_tbf polled for data without being in FLOW state Prior code was wrong, as in it did stuff diferent to what is expected and actually done in osmo-pcu. In osmo-pcu code, the function is guarded and only called in FLOW or FINISHED state by the scheduler.
